This quick reference guide from Kristin Van Marter Souers and Pete Hall introduces the new three Rs of education: relationship, responsibility, and regulation. These three Rs will support teachers in designing interventions aimed at meeting four areas of student need: emotional, relational, physical, and control.
The guide includes
-The difference between need and behavior
-The most common needs we see students expressing
-6 steps to reaching students
-7 key things to remember when addressing student needs
-10 recommended things the brain needs to be healthy
The guide's many strategies will help K–12 teachers learn more about their students, uncover unmet needs, and build trauma-invested environments.
